Overview

Digitap is an AI-powered API platform for Banking and FinTech teams that need to automate customer onboarding and financial-data analysis. The homepage positions it as a SaaS offering for BFSI and other financial institutions, with a focus on underwriting, verification, and customer onboarding workflows.

Its published modules cover digital onboarding, alternate-data credit evaluation, account aggregation via a certified TSP, and an expense manager SDK for accessing customer spending data. The product is presented as an API-based plug-in solution intended to speed implementation and support scale across customer onboarding and related decisioning workflows.

Core capabilities

Digital onboarding APIs

Digitap’s onboarding suite covers digital customer onboarding with Digital KYC, OCR-based document handling, KYC document validation, and Video KYC.

Alternate-data underwriting

The alternate data suite assesses credit worthiness using data sources such as bank statements, device data, e-commerce data, social media data, and telecom data.

Account Aggregator support

Digitap acts as a certified TSP for Account Aggregator workflows and provides an FIU module with integrations to account aggregators, along with variables used in credit underwriting.

Expense access and insights

The expense manager SDK lets clients access customer expenses and surface personalized, contextual insights for cross-sell use cases.

API-first delivery model

The homepage describes an API-based plug-in approach designed to support faster integrations and dedicated project support for launch.

Practical use cases

  • Digital customer onboarding

    Teams can use Digitap to build digital onboarding flows that combine KYC document checks, OCR, and Video KYC for customer verification.

  • Credit underwriting

    Lenders can assess applicants with alternate data such as bank statements, device signals, e-commerce activity, social data, and telecom data when traditional information is limited.

  • Account Aggregator integration

    Institutions using Account Aggregator workflows can connect through Digitap’s FIU module to access variables that support underwriting decisions.

  • Expense analysis and cross-sell

    Product teams can access customer expense data through the SDK and generate contextual insights for cross-sell campaigns or offer recommendations.
